Mobility Across Diverse Terrain

For LPCSAR, our county is a diverse combination of deserts, river valleys, aspen forests, canyons, and alpine passes. Our SAR Moto Team operates across the rugged Four Corners region, from the high desert near the New Mexico border to the alpine trails north of Durango. In this unforgiving terrain, mobility is not a luxury, it’s an operational necessity. Our Moto Team utilizes:

  • 2-stroke and 4-stroke dirt bikes for narrow singletrack and fast reconnaissance.
  • Electric dirt bikes, nearly silent and ideal for subject detection.
  • Side-by-sides (UTVs) capable of transporting gear, personnel, and sometimes even canine handlers.
  • ATVs used to tow mobile litters and traverse winter and mud-heavy conditions where other vehicles may struggle.

These platforms allow our teams to extend the reach of ground operations, cover more ground than hiking teams alone, and adapt to changing mission requirements. Whether accessing an alpine meadow six miles in or scouting side drainages along a canyon wall, our SAR Moto Team reduces time-to-subject dramatically. We’ve also used UTVs to transport canine teams deep into remote areas, preserving the dogs’ stamina and enabling a full shift of productive searching without early fatigue.

The Right Tool for the Right Job

We don’t deploy dirt bikes simply because they are fast. We use them because in certain conditions, they are the correct tool for the task. Matching equipment to mission profiles is a cornerstone of our strategy. Each deployment is preceded by a situational analysis of terrain, weather, and risk.

Electric dirt bikes are an increasingly important part of our fleet. They’re quiet, have instant torque, and eliminate the loud mechanical roar of a traditional engine, making it easier for operators to hear distant whistles, calls, or movement in the woods. Their lower acoustic profile also allows better radio communication between field teams and Incident Command. For missions requiring extraction or prolonged operations, side-by-sides or ATVs can tow litters, ferry responders, or haul heavy loads like shelter systems, lighting, and emergency gear. They also serve a vital logistical role, supporting Hasty Teams, UAS teams, and even acting as relay points when terrain prevents direct radio contact.

Real-World SAR Examples

One of the clearest demonstrations of the Moto Team’s effectiveness occurred during an incident response to a subject injured deep within a side canyon of Hermosa Creek. While air support inserted teams by helicopter, our SAR Moto Team navigated several miles of rugged backcountry trails and was the first to make contact with the subject. This ground-based contact stabilized the situation before air assets arrived, proving that speed on two wheels can sometimes rival flight in the right terrain.

In another extended operation, nightfall caught several field teams still deployed. The Moto Team was dispatched to shuttle in water, headlamps, and specialty gear, ensuring that teams could remain on task and stay safe. Because of their compact profile and rapid speed, our Moto units closed the logistical gap between Incident Command (IC) and the field with remarkable efficiency. Risk Management on Every Ride

Operating motorized vehicles in wilderness terrain adds risk. We mitigate that risk through deliberate planning, strong training, and the structured use of the GAR (Green/Amber/Red) risk assessment tool. By focusing on pre-mission analysis and real-time conditions, our team avoids unnecessary exposure while maximizing effectiveness.

Every mission involving the SAR Moto Team includes GAR card assessments based on rider experience, terrain type, lighting, weather, and urgency. These are not rubber-stamped approvals. They are real discussions with Search Management Team (SMT) leaders and the assigned field personnel.

Using GAR helps us decide when to deploy Moto assets and when not to. For instance, steep scree fields after a rainstorm may turn a relaxed green-rated trail into a red-risk operation. Our leaders always defer to safety, even if that means taking longer to reach a subject. Our SAR Moto Team Philosophy

We believe our role as a Moto Team is to serve as a force multiplier for our ground and air resources. That means operating with independence but always in alignment with IC and SMT goals. It also means:

  • Training regularly in technical terrain.
  • Coordinating closely with other SAR teams.
  • Supporting logistical needs like supply runs or subject extraction.
  • Understanding subject behavior models and using them to route our patrols.

Although our Moto Team often focuses on being the first into new terrain or making subject contact, all LPCSAR team members are trained in WFA protocols and expected to maintain strong skills in GPS navigation, CalTopo mapping, and radio communication. These are foundational capabilities for everyone on our team, regardless of specialty.

As a Search and Rescue team, we recognize that every mission in the backcountry comes with a responsibility to protect the environment and set an example. Our OHV riders strictly adhere to all U.S. Forest Service and local land agency regulations, and we are committed to Leave No Trace principles. Whether responding to a call or training on remote trails, we yield to hikers, slow down for equestrians, and maintain courteous communication with fellow trail users. Mutual respect helps preserve public access and builds trust between our team and the outdoor community we serve.
